The Wabash Valley College Warriors are headed to Hutchinson after defeating Lake Land College 87-72 in Region 24 at Rend Lake College in Ina, I.L.
Advertisement
The Warriors were led in scoring by Region 24 Player of the Year and Kent State commitment Chris Evans with 24 points. Ian Chiles a freshman combo guard from Louisville,KY scored 14 points. Chiles is an academic qualifier and can leave with three years left to play.
Coach Sparks is currently in his 5th season with the Warriors in Mount Carmel, I.L. Sparks previously coached 26 years at nearby Vincennes University. The Warriors will be making their first appearance at the NJCAA National Tourney since 2002 when they won it all under then head coach Jay Spoonhour.
